    I can see that apple picking here is going to become a Fall tradition for our family.  The drive here through small towns and country lanes was relaxing, and the small orchard was just the right size for an hour or two of relaxed picking. It doesn't have a extensive store or silly petting zoo, which I liked because those places tend to be unfocused.

    We were impressed with the wide variety of apples, which you don't normally see in the stores, and concentrated our efforts on the more interesting flavors that included a tasty sweet sour pear-like variety with rough skin, called Hawthornes Golden Gem. Others good ones: Mutsu, Connell Red, Snow.

    You can "taste-drive" and share as you walk, to narrow you slesctions down. We'll probably go back again in a couple weeks, as our 1/2 bushel is getting low, and the Autumn colors signal a good time to pick sweeter apples.

    Start at the top of the hill and work your way back, as the bags can get heavy. I was impressed with how sturdy the bag they provide is, and how it's family run. I saw maybe four generations there on the weekend we went. It gets busy, so go early in the day.

    Such a nice alternative to the giant apple-picking-plus-circus type orchards I've been to.

    This small, family-run establishment has the widest selection of apple varieties I've ever seen: standards like Gala, Golden Delicious, McIntosh and Honeycrisp, plus varieties I'd never heard of: Sweet Sixteen, Lustre Elstar,  Connell Red, Spitzenburg, Jonagold, Mutsu ... it was great fun comparing the different varieties.

    The trees were heavy with fruit. The biggest problem was deciding which to pick.

    Pick by the peck ($15) or half-bushel. They also had pumpkins, squash and some homegrown veggies for sale. Windfall apples half-price ("for sauce or a treat for your horse"). And no hooplah. If you want exotic animal petting zoo and giant inflatable moonwalks, you'll need to look elsewhere.

    My fiancee and I have been going here for the last 4 years.  I absolutely love them; they specialize in "unheard" of varieties, although there's some old favorites too.   Each year, they remember us, which is impressive considering they see us all of about 1 hour every 365 days.

    Speaking of which - we go out early in the season to pick 1/2 bushel of the early varieties, which are generally great for eating but don't last as long.  We return about 3 or 4 weeks later for the longer lasting varieties.  We keep 'em in the downstairs fridge and are still making applesauce and pies several months later.

    One year the mosquitos were horrendous, although generally they haven't been a problem - just a heads up you might want to bring some spray just in case.

    IMPORTANT:  if you're looking for hay rides, pumpkin patches, scarecrows, taffy apples, etc etc THIS IS NOT THE PLACE FOR YOU.  This is for fantastic apple picking in a beautiful setting; it won't take you long to pick your apples and be on your way!
